Food Security workshop 2: Specifications
The workshop covers the following:
· How to take an NPD recipe and turn into a finished product specification
· How to review raw material specifications and use the information to set goods in tests or inspections
· Understand the link between raw material specifications and goods in checks and tests
· Understand the importance of intermediate product specification for product quality
· Signpost to sources of information for specification preparation and review
· Specification review
· Specification audits
